The American Wood Council recently released a new publication for fire design of wood members, assemblies, and connections to meet code requirements.
Since 2001, the National Design Specification for Wood Construction has provided provisions for the structural design of unprotected wood members exposed to a standardized ASTM E119 fire exposure. The 2021 Fire Design Specification for Wood Construction (FDS) contains these provisions, and also provides calculation procedures to address the added fire resistance and thermal benefits of protection provided by additional wood cover, gypsum panel products, and insulation.
The additional calculation provisions have been developed to provide standardized methods of calculating thermal separation and burn-through requirements as required in ASTM E119 and as provided in AWC’s Technical Report 10: Calculating the Fire Resistance of Exposed and Protected Wood Members (TR10).
